I'm correct that the BIOS/FIRMWARE on an 8800 series card does NOT determine the hardware thats reported to GPUZ and the likes? I've bought another 8800GT and noticed it was running slower than expected - looking at it in GPUZ shows 12 rops, 96 streaming processors, 384Mb 192bit RAM - basically an 8800GS but someones taken the time to reflash it with an 8800GT firmware - I've already sent a message to the shop but I want to make double sure its not a simple manufacturing error that can solved by flashing with the correct GT BIOS?